    The way I see it is that buying into REITs such as this one you're not after capital growth but rather the dividend income that it is able to provide. I haven't been able to do a full analysis of CIP yet hence why I don't have a position but based on what i've seen so far, you have a business that holds investments with a decent WALE and cap rates on the lower end of the market (indicating a less risky investment). This will help with them providing consistent dividends to shareholders.

    Definitely not an exciting listing in comparison to the huge tech companies but I believe these sort of listings can play a great role in building passive income in the long term
